Check out the month-by-month weather chart for Yarmouth to help you plan your next trip. With a monthly average of 64.0 degrees Fahrenheit, you can expect the hottest temperatures in August. The coldest month, on average, is February. The most rainfall typically happens in December. Regardless of when you visit Yarmouth, every season has a reason to stay.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ationcloud iconCloudiness
January31.6°F (-0.2°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
February30.9°F (-0.6°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
March34.5°F (1.4°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
April41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
May49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
June56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
July62.8°F (17.1°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
August64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
September60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
October53.1°F (11.7°C)Light RainMostly Sunny
November44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
December37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ly Cloudy
